Output fbab122b4a2e5ee9a47859cb2d78ffadac958d869ca4234159bcc0fa9ede17c9:1

value
21939063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f813b4f629859598914466bbd5930119e20c5a OP_EQUAL
address
3MepR44M5CwtVNGXNTK5o3QPbvbXMJJprD
transaction
fbab122b4a2e5ee9a47859cb2d78ffadac958d869ca4234159bcc0fa9ede17c9
spent
true